COOKING TIP: It's all in the proof! Remove the croissants from their packaging and place them seam-side down on a lined baking sheet. Lightly mist them with water, cover them loosely, and let them rise in a warm spot for 8 hours. You'll know they're ready when they've doubled in size and spring back slowly when lightly pressed. When ready to cook, preheat the oven to 400°F. Remove the croissant covering and brush with milk or cream, if desired. Reduce heat to 375°F and place the baking sheet with croissants on the middle rack. Bake for 18 to 22 minutes until deep, golden brown, and crisp. Remove from the oven and let cool for 20 minutes before serving.
